What is AFP Nonprofit Membership

The AFP Membership Application for Large Nonprofits is a business form used by large nonprofit organizations to apply for membership in the Association of Fundraising Professionals (AFP).

Who Should Use the AFP Membership Application for Large Nonprofits?

This application is specifically designed for key decision-makers within large nonprofit organizations. The eligible roles that should use the AFP Membership Application include:
  • CEO
  • Chief Fundraising Officer
  • Board Chair
These positions are critical for ensuring that the application is submitted correctly and represent organizations that stand to gain the most from AFP membership.

Signature Requirements for the AFP Membership Application for Large Nonprofits

Signing the AFP Membership Application is a necessary step in the process. The following requirements must be met:
  • The application must be signed by either the CEO, Chief Fundraising Officer, or Board Chair.
  • Clarification exists on whether a digital signature can replace a traditional wet signature, accommodating modern signing practices.
This ensures that the application is valid and acknowledges organizational approval before submission.
